Ok guys so im kinda new to the game. I have a 1987 Buick Grand National. I want a nice street car that I can throw on slicks and run low tweleves, but but still be able to drive the car whenever. Everuthing is.stock besides the mods i will mention. I want to know the best things to do next, and if I missing nething from my current equation.

Comp Cams High Energery flat tappet 212 cam, hi flow oil pump, lifters, new timing chain, all new gaskets, thrust plate, heavy valve springs.

42lb injectors, 255lh fuel pump, hotwire fuel pump harness, new heavy duty wastegate, rjc boost controller, new ignition moduel, turbotweak custon chip, 4inch maf, 3inch up pipe, and bigmouth cold air. Thanks guys!!
